What Does DWS Stand For?

DWS stands for Dropwindsonde

DWS, or Dropwindsonde, is a meteorological instrument used to collect atmospheric data from various altitudes during flight missions. The device is typically deployed from aircraft and descends through the atmosphere, measuring parameters such as wind speed, wind direction, temperature, humidity, and pressure. The data gathered by dropwindsondes is crucial for weather forecasting, climate research, and the study of severe weather events, contributing valuable insights for meteorologists and researchers in understanding atmospheric dynamics.
